Feeds (Version 0.4.1)
Since the last release, Feeds brushed up its language skills and now contains four additional translations. This means you can already enjoy Feeds in a total of seven languages. Many thanks go out to the translators, who are:
Antonio Soler (Spanish)
Kyosuke Takayama (Japanese)
Fabio Mosetti (Italian)
Jerry Lee (Traditional Chinese)
Jay Sun (Chinese)
I also fixed a few things here and there and added a simplistic ‘Star’ button, so you can easily keep track of those special entries that you want to read again on a bigger screen free of finger smudges. Hi, i’ve been using feeds for 2 weeks, and i upgraded to 0.4.1 but i’ve got the same problem as Selbs, the page is in asian caraters…
I still can, read my news but, it seems to be an issue.
I reply to myself: i changed the asian font to chinese and it solved my problem.
(In parameters/general/International/Asian font)
Tks a lot anyway
